One of P.T. Barnum's most famous sideshow attractions was the Fiji Mermaid, a composite mummy half-fish and half orangutan, said to have been captured off Fiji. Throughout the early years of our century, composite creatures were displayed in carnival sideshows across the country as curiosities of the natural world.
